Understanding Prepositions in Afrikaans

Prepositions in Afrikaans, as in other languages, are words that link nouns, pronouns, or phrases to other words within a sentence. They typically describe relationships related to time, place, direction, cause, manner, and possession. Learning prepositions in Afrikaans is vital because:

Afrikaans prepositions often function similarly to their English counterparts but can have unique usages and idiomatic expressions that learners must familiarize themselves with.
